About the job:
Joining Pure Travel Group involves being part of a team that loves inspiring clients through tailor-made and sustainable travel experiences across South America and Antarctica. You will be part of a great work environment and an international community made up of all our offices in South America.
As a travel designer, you will support the sales team in designing captivating itineraries highlighting the best of Bolivia and caring for all the specific details to meet clients' expectations.
Responsibilities:
- Be responsible for selecting cutting-edge tourist products in Bolivia.
- Design itineraries with experiences and activities for B2B clients according to the company's vision, guidelines, policies, procedures, quality, and safety criteria of the company's offerings.
- Attention to detail and high level of customer service.

About us
Pure Travel Group is a Destination Management Company specializing in the B2B market for incentive and leisure travel in Colombia, Ecuador, Peru, Bolivia, Chile, Argentina, and selected cruise expeditions in Antarctica.
